SwiftUI agent skill's intelligence for `if #available` checks and minimum deployment targets.
Raw Developer Origin & Technical Request
GitHub Issue
Mar 5, 2026
I don't know if this better fits the hygiene or swift file, but, I'd like to see the agent be told to check `if #available` checks against the minimum target. If the minimum target matches or is higher than the condition, delete delete delete!
Don't actually have the agent delete the branch that isn't needed anymore, but flag it and report to the user to make a decision to delete it.
Sometimes exploring for deprecations or trialing new APIs (looking at you DeclaredAgeRange), developers will bring the minimum SDK all the way up, I'd hate to see things get deleted arbitrarily there when detecting deprecations or just forcing the code to have access to all of the latest APIs for what ever reason.
Developer Debate & Comments
No active discussions extracted for this entry yet.
Adjacent Repository Pain Points
Other highly discussed features and pain points extracted from twostraws/SwiftUI-Agent-Skill.
Engagement Signals
Cross-Market Term Frequency
Quantifies the cross-market adoption of foundational terms like Claude Code and SwiftUI agent skill by tracking occurrence frequency across active SaaS architectures and enterprise developer debates.
Market Trends